React建站 React在网站开发领域广泛应用,详解其优势及开发关键点

通过jzz

React建站 React在网站开发领域广泛应用,详解其优势及开发关键点

React是一款功能强大的JavaScript库,它在网站开发领域得到了广泛的应用。借助React进行网站开发,开发者能够更高效地掌控应用的状态,并构建出交互性强的用户界面。接下来,我将为大家详细阐述React网站开发的关键点。

React优势

React拥有虚拟DOM的功能,这一特性使得它在刷新页面时能高效地识别差异,仅对需变更的部分进行更新,从而大幅提高了页面的运行效率。此外,React支持组件化编程,每个组件都具备独立的逻辑与功能,这使得开发者能够更有效地管理和复用代码,进一步提高了开发的工作效率。在网站建设过程中,采用React技术可以显著提升开发速度。具体来说,这个网站就是利用了React,从而缩短了开发所需的时间。

环境搭建

构建React开发环境,需先安装Node.js和npm软件。安装妥当后,借助Create React App工具,我们便能迅速启动一个全新的React项目。该工具能自动完成开发环境和构建工具的配置,使我们能集中精力进行代码编写。这对初学者来说极为方便,省去了繁琐的配置步骤。

组件创建

React建站

React框架中,组件是构建用户界面不可或缺的要素。我们能够构建函数式组件,其代码简明扼要,易于阅读,非常适合用于简单的展示功能;同时,我们还可以创建类组件,这类组件具备独立的状态和生命周期方法,适合处理复杂的交互需求。通过合理地构建和使用组件,可以使得网站的结构变得更加清晰有序。

状态管理

对于基础的状态控制,React自带的state功能已能满足需求。然而,在规模较大的项目中,引入Redux或MobX等专门的状态管理库将更为适宜。这些库能够让我们更高效地集中管理应用的状态,确保状态变化具有可预测性和可追踪性,从而显著提高代码的维护质量。

部署上线

网站开发完毕后,便需着手进行上线部署。我们可以选择将网站安置于云服务器,比如阿里云、腾讯云等,以此来保障网站的稳定运行和可靠性能。此外,还可以借助一些静态网站托管服务,例如Netlify,这些服务通常拥有简便的部署步骤,并提供免费套餐供用户选择。

在使用React搭建网站的过程中,你是否遇到了一些挑战?不妨点赞并转发这篇文章,然后在评论区留下你的想法,让我们共同探讨。

关于作者

jzz administrator

发表评论